WWI 16th Infantry Battalion Pin CEF
WWI 16th Infantry Battalion Pin CEF - Silver and enamels, hallmarked with the British lion, an anchor (made in Birmingham), date marked "r" (1916) maker marked "G.A & S." on the reverse, 28 mm x 33.3 mm, vertical pinback, enamel chipping in the crown and ribbon banner, better than very fine. Footnote: The Battalion was raised in British Columbia, Manitoba and Ontario and mobilized at Camp Valcartier, Quebec under the authority of P.C.O. 2067, August 6, 1914. The Battalion sailed October 3, 1914 with a strength of 47 officers and 1,096 other ranks under the command of Lieutenant-Colonel R.G. Edwards Leckie. The Battalion served in France and Belgium with the 3rd Infantry Brigade, 1st Canadian Division. It was disbanded September 15, 1920.
